Science on stage Albania is going to organize a National Workshop. In Cooperation with Science on Stage partner, we aim to create this event described as below: The event will take place in Edu Act Albania Center in Tirana, Albania. This event is going to be organized in October 13, during all day. This event is going to be organized as a workshop. In this workshop we are going to present the Coding Clubs that will be created before the workshop in different schools in Albania. In this workshop is going to be presented coding done by this schools showing the best work. Also, we are going to present a class coding training, during this day, where some teachers and students are selected to be trained into our center. ACTIVITIES: 1. Teacher training 2. Butterfly Algorithms
Computational thinking is a problem-solving process that is used in everyday life as well as computer programs. In this lesson, students apply their computational thinking skills to explore the life cycle of a butterfly. They'll create an algorithm, or set of instructions, to model the life cycle of a butterfly. They will write this algorithm using conditionals and then program it on a computer.
Students will:
- Analyze the life cycle of a butterfly.
- Develop an algorithm that describes the cycle.
- Apply conditionals to an algorithm.
- Finish and test the algorithm of a computer program to demonstrate the life cycle of a butterfly.
